Lithium-Ion Battery Charging ICs, Texas Instruments
Integrated battery charging ICs from Texas Instruments intended for use with Lithium-Ion & Lithium-Polymer cells. These devices provide a complete charging and monitoring solution and include internal power devices capable of supplying charging currents of up to several amps.
